ROSEHIPS
Actions: aperiant, astringent
Rosehips Granules are one of the very best sources of natural Iron and Vitamin C. They also contain biotin for optimum hoof health. They are an excellent spring tonic. Useful for scouring, general debility and for helping horses return to health after illness. Will aid in fighting infection. Or use fresh rose hips!!
